Abstract
The electrolyte-specific solvation parameter regarding the ionic solvation, and approaching parameter regarding the closest distance of approach between ions, in a electrolyte solution were defined by Lin and Lee [Fluid Phase Equil. 205 (2003) 69-83]. In this study, these two electrolyte-specific parameters of individual ions were correlated with the activity coefficients of ions in different aqueous single-electrolyte solutions from literature. With these two parameters and the two-ionic-parameter approach of Lin and Lee, the individual activity coefficients of the ions in the solutions of fourteen 1:1 type, two 1:2 type, and six 2:1 type electrolytes were calculated and compared to the literature values. Also the comparisons of the predicted and literature osmotic coefficients of aqueous multi-electrolyte solutions were reported. The results showed the estimated values fairly agree to the literature data.
